Could Remote Teaching End Snow Days After COVID-19?
(TNS) - After more than a month of online school because of stay-at-home orders, district leaders in the Kansas City, Mo., area half-jokingly talk about one consequence for the future of education. Students might not want to hear it, but "remote teaching could put an end to snow days," said Charles Foust, superintendent of Kansas City, Kansas Public Schools.
